I have a an idea of developing a preprocessor that allows ActionScript developers to optimize their code by in lining functions and variables. This plugin will work with Adobe Flex Plugin and modifies source code sent to compiler. I think, to make this happen i need to solve following problems :
If i used Meta Tags to mark which functions and variables will inline, i need to find a way to bypass this meta tags in Eclipse (or Flex) code checking routines. Because Flex will ignores this tags and bubbles errors. Maybe there is a way of introducing this meta tags into Eclipse IDE. I found [Meta Tag] is supported by Flex and its allows to use customs as well.
A way to process this tags and move to desired source code location these inlining functions and variables without developing a whole compiler or source code exploring library. Maybe by utilizing existing Exlipse (or Flex) source code exploring futures.
A way to modify source code sent to compiler.
